What happened and why it matters
Elutia reported Q2 2026 results and detailed a non-dilutive funding plan of up to $26 million to support NXT-41x through FDA clearance and a 2028 commercial launch. Independent surgeon data show strong demand for NXT-41x, with expected FDA clearances in late 2026 and mid-2027, while asset divestitures sharpen focus and extend the cash runway into 2028. A successful launch could unlock meaningful upside given high infection-risk perceptions with current matrices.
Non-dilutive funding reduces equity risk while FDA clearance milestones establish near-term catalysts. Strong surgeon demand supports throughput for NXT-41x, and divestitures sharpen focus, potentially improving margins and cash runway. However, outcomes hinge on regulatory approvals and execution of the commercial launch.
Elutia secures up to $26M capital without equity offering.
FDA clearance timing: NXT-41 in 4Q2026; NXT-41x in 1H2027.
Independent surgeon survey shows strong adoption demand for NXT-41x.
SimpliDerm divestiture closes 3Q2026; BioEnvelope escrow release in 4Q2026.
Strategic focus shifts toward NXT-41x with runway extending to 2028 launch.
